Steps for making red flower bonsai

Preliminary preparation

If you want to make a beautiful bonsai of red flowered genista, you can’t do without flowerpots, soil and plants. Before you officially start making it, you must first choose the flowerpots and plants. There is no need to say more about this. You can choose the flowerpots according to your preferences, and choose plants that grow vigorously. Let's focus on the preparation of the soil. Red flower sempervivum is suitable for growing in alkaline soil. Therefore, in addition to being loose, breathable and fertile, the soil also needs to have a certain alkalinity, at least it cannot be acidic soil.


Digging stumps

The best time to dig up tree stumps is in spring, preferably around the vernal equinox. The growth state of the tree stumps is the best at this time. The wounds left after digging are easy to heal, and the vitality of the bonsai produced will be relatively vigorous.


Stump pruning

After the tree stumps are collected, they need to be pruned according to their thickness and shape. Mainly, some useless branches should be pruned away, leaving the main trunk and branches for future shaping. In addition, part of the residual roots on the stumps should be pruned away, trying not to damage the fibrous roots.


Stump cultivation

The tree stumps we generally choose are those that are not very large. If these stumps happen to have more fibrous roots, they can be planted directly in pots. However, if the stumps are thicker and larger or have fewer fibrous roots, the survival rate will be greatly reduced if they are planted directly in pots. They should be planted in the soil for a period of time before being potted.


Pruning and shaping of red flower bonsai

Generally, many new roots will grow three months after being potted. At this time, the red flower sempervivum can basically be pruned and topped. In order to prevent it from growing too high, it needs to be topped off every once in a while. In addition, the external shape of the red flowered bonsai can be determined according to your own preferences, such as the most common spherical shape, of course, it can also be a triangle, or a funny gourd shape.


Things to pay attention to when making bonsai of red flower

The first thing is to be careful not to damage the roots when digging up tree stumps, otherwise it will be detrimental to the survival after potting. Second, the soil cannot be acidic, and it must be loose, breathable and not barren. Finally, it is necessary to pinch the top of the tree regularly to prevent it from growing continuously upwards and affecting the shape of the entire bonsai.
